This is a description of a toothpaste product with active ingredient sodium monofluorophosphate designed to help prevent dental cavities. It is a warning label to keep this product out of the reach of children under six years of age, and in case of accidental swallowing, medical help or a Poison Control Center should be contacted right away. The toothpaste should be used regularly to help protect teeth, and the user should stop using the product and seek expert advice in case of pain or sensitivity persisting after four weeks of use. Directions for use are also provided. Inactive ingredients include calcium carbonate, flavor, and water, among others. The product is distributed by Universal Distribution Center, located in Easton, New Jersey, USA.*
